Has anyone at all experienced this noise in your stateroom? It appears to be in the ceiling and walls.  The ship is full and Celebrity cannot move us but this is outrageous. It’s all throughout the night, so bad that this is day 2 of the voyage with no sleep. This is not a creaking noise that this class of ships has been known for but a banging noise. Never have I ever experienced this before. Stateroom is at the front of the ship.

 

 

 

any advice on how to handle this even post cruise is much appreciated as this has been such a disaster.

We were in 6135 on the Ascent in January.  "Snap, Crackle, Pop" was very annoying during the day, but made it very hard to sleep at night.  After second night of limited sleep (hard mattress was also responsible), we went to Guest Relations.  GR said they would send someone to look into the problem.  To our extreme surprise, the noise was gone -- totally gone!  I recommend going to GR with your complaint.

Unfortunately, yes, I experienced this on Beyond.  It definitely is a known problem…albeit not one that seems to be often able to be fixed.  There needs to be some kind of modification in the ship’s design.  Please go to Guest Services as often as necessary to get some resolution. I don’t believe there are no other cabins they could move you to…I think they just don’t want to set a precedent.
